Eggs are a delicious and nutritious breakfast idea. If your diet doesn’t tolerate eggs, try egg whites and egg yolks separately. Some people don’t tolerate the egg protein in the egg white and some people don’t do well with the fat in the egg yolk. Testing each part separately means you can figure out what you tolerate and what you don’t, which might help you add a new food to your diet too! If you test both and still don’t feel like either is working for you, definitely keep them out and retest them again later. For those who tolerate eggs, they can be your best friend! ❤️🥚

Scrambled or fried eggs are an easy breakfast. For scrambled eggs, throw in some spinach (or other greens), leftover veggies, bacon or homemade sausage for extra nutrition and taste. Or make and freeze breakfast egg muffins in advance (there are tons of awesome, easy recipes on the internet for these.) You can also find pre-packaged hard boiled eggs at Costco or other grocery stores. Just make sure to review the ingredients to ensure there are no other spices or additives. Hard boiled eggs are great with a dollop of pesto, as tolerated.
